Output 6216de8a81bc8fec72efead71d9c876b2f5b5eb53730b5fa572e6eff7832f4ea:7

value
6370371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afb3337ddc254db7ff09371813052928c18b45e OP_EQUAL
address
38XUrRfmq3vBVXVXTuU7N1AyTjzGA32bqd
transaction
6216de8a81bc8fec72efead71d9c876b2f5b5eb53730b5fa572e6eff7832f4ea
spent
true